Bug#584350: refcard: FTBFS: xmlroff segfaults
Source: refcard
Version: 5.0.5-3
Severity: serious
Tags: squeeze sid
User: debian-qa@lists.debian.org
Usertags: qa-ftbfs-20100602 qa-ftbfs
Justification: FTBFS on amd64
Hi,
During a rebuild of all packages in sid, your package failed to build on
amd64.
Relevant part:
> XSLT stylesheets DocBook - LaTeX 2e (0.3-1)
> ===================================================
> Processing Revision History
> Build refcard-it.dbk.pdf
> This is XeTeX, Version 3.1415926-2.2-0.9995.2 (TeX Live 2009/Debian)
> restricted \write18 enabled.
> entering extended mode
>
> ** WARNING ** Annotation out of page boundary.
> ** WARNING ** Current page's MediaBox: [0 0 280.63 595.276]
> ** WARNING ** Annotation: [129.765 551.505 218.432 661.094]
> ** WARNING ** Maybe incorrect paper size specified.
> This is XeTeX, Version 3.1415926-2.2-0.9995.2 (TeX Live 2009/Debian)
> restricted \write18 enabled.
> entering extended mode
>
> ** WARNING ** Annotation out of page boundary.
> ** WARNING ** Current page's MediaBox: [0 0 280.63 595.276]
> ** WARNING ** Annotation: [129.765 551.505 218.432 661.094]
> ** WARNING ** Maybe incorrect paper size specified.
> This is XeTeX, Version 3.1415926-2.2-0.9995.2 (TeX Live 2009/Debian)
> restricted \write18 enabled.
> entering extended mode
>
> ** WARNING ** Annotation out of page boundary.
> ** WARNING ** Current page's MediaBox: [0 0 280.63 595.276]
> ** WARNING ** Annotation: [129.765 551.505 218.432 661.094]
> ** WARNING ** Maybe incorrect paper size specified.
> 'refcard-it-a4.s.pdf' successfully built
> pdfjoin --vanilla --fitpaper true --outfile refcard-it-a4.s.pdf.x.pdf refcard-it-a4.s.pdf empty.pdf empty.pdf
> ----
> pdfjam: This is pdfjam version 2.05.
> pdfjam: Called with '--vanilla': no user or site configuration
> files will be read.
> pdfjam: Effective call for this run of pdfjam:
> /usr/bin/pdfjam --fitpaper 'true' --rotateoversize 'true' --suffix joined --vanilla --fitpaper 'true' --outfile refcard-it-a4.s.pdf.x.pdf -- refcard-it-a4.s.pdf - empty.pdf - empty.pdf -
> pdfjam: Calling pdflatex...
> pdfjam: Finished. Output was to 'refcard-it-a4.s.pdf.x.pdf'.
> pdfnup --vanilla --nup 3x1 --outfile refcard-it-a4.t.pdf --paper a4paper refcard-it-a4.s.pdf.x.pdf 5-6,1-4
> ----
> pdfjam: This is pdfjam version 2.05.
> pdfjam: Called with '--vanilla': no user or site configuration
> files will be read.
> pdfjam: Effective call for this run of pdfjam:
> /usr/bin/pdfjam --suffix nup --nup '2x1' --landscape --vanilla --nup '3x1' --outfile refcard-it-a4.t.pdf --paper a4paper -- refcard-it-a4.s.pdf.x.pdf 5-6,1-4
> pdfjam: Calling pdflatex...
> pdfjam: Finished. Output was to 'refcard-it-a4.t.pdf'.
> rm refcard-it-a4.s.pdf.x.pdf
> L=`echo refcard-it-a4.pdf | sed 's/.*-\(.*\)-.*/\1/'`; \
> xsltproc --nonet --novalid metadata.xsl entries-$L.dbk | \
> pdftk refcard-it-a4.t.pdf update_info - output refcard-it-a4.pdf
> xsltproc --nonet --novalid preproc.xsl entries-ja.dbk > refcard-ja.dbk
> xsltproc --nonet --novalid fo.xsl refcard-ja.dbk > refcard-ja-a4.fo
> Making portrait pages on USletter paper (99mmx210mm)
> L=`echo refcard-ja-a4.s.pdf | sed 's/.*-\(.*\)-.*/\1/'`; \
> USE_XR=`echo " ar cs el he hi ja ml sk zh_CN zh_TW " | grep " $L "`; \
> if [ -n "$USE_XR" ]; then \
> USE_GP=`echo " ar eu he hi ja sv " | grep " $L "`; \
> if [ -n "$USE_GP" ]; then \
> xmlroff --backend gp -o refcard-ja-a4.s.pdf refcard-ja-a4.fo; \
> else \
> xmlroff --backend cairo -o refcard-ja-a4.s.pdf refcard-ja-a4.fo; \
> fi; \
> else \
> if [ -n "$USE_DBLATEX" ]; then \
> SRC=`echo refcard-ja-a4.fo|sed 's/-\(a4\|lt\).fo/.dbk/'`; \
> FMT=`echo refcard-ja-a4.fo|sed 's/.*-\(a4\|lt\).fo/\1/'`; \
> dblatex --backend=xetex --texstyle=refcard.sty --xsl-user=dblatex.xsl --output=refcard-ja-a4.s.pdf --param=format=$FMT $SRC; \
> else \
> fop refcard-ja-a4.fo refcard-ja-a4.s.pdf; \
> fi; \
> fi
>
> (xmlroff:24762): libfo-WARNING **: fo-area-page-error: Child area overflows parent area
> Object path: /FoAreaTree[1]/FoAreaPage[4]/FoAreaViewportReference[1]
>
> (xmlroff:24762): libfo-WARNING **: fo-area-page-error: Child area overflows parent area
> Object path: /FoAreaTree[1]/FoAreaPage[4]/FoAreaViewportReference[1]
>
> (xmlroff:24762): libfo-WARNING **: fo-area-page-error: Child area overflows parent area
> Object path: /FoAreaTree[1]/FoAreaPage[4]/FoAreaViewportReference[1]
>
> ** (xmlroff:24762): WARNING **: IPP request failed with status 1280
>
> ** (xmlroff:24762): WARNING **: IPP request failed with status 1280
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
> [...]
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
>
> (xmlroff:24762): GnomePrint-CRITICAL **: gnome_rfont_get_glyph_stdadvance: assertion `glyph < GRF_NUM_GLYPHS (rfont)' failed
> Segmentation fault
> make[1]: *** [refcard-ja-a4.s.pdf] Error 139
The full build log is available from:
http://people.debian.org/~lucas/logs/2010/06/02/refcard_5.0.5-3_lsid64.buildlog
A list of current common problems and possible solutions is available at
http://wiki.debian.org/qa.debian.org/FTBFS . You're welcome to contribute!
About the archive rebuild: The rebuild was done on about 50 AMD64 nodes
of the Grid'5000 platform, using a clean chroot. Internet was not
accessible from the build systems.
--
| Lucas Nussbaum
| lucas@lucas-nussbaum.net http://www.lucas-nussbaum.net/ |
| jabber: lucas@nussbaum.fr GPG: 1024D/023B3F4F |
Reply to: